Nimbus Manticore is an Iranian state-sponsored cyber-espionage actor assessed to be affiliated with the Islamic Revolutionary Guard Corps. It is widely tracked as UNC1549 and Smoke Sandstorm, and has also been reported as GalaxyGato, Mirage Kitten, Subtle Snail, and Screening Serpens. The group has conducted sustained intelligence-collection operations against aerospace, aviation, defense, telecommunications, software, government, financial, and other strategically relevant organizations across the Middle East, Africa, South Asia, Europe, Australia, and the United States. Nimbus Manticore is particularly associated with recruitment-themed social engineering. Its operators impersonate recruiters, employers, and prominent aerospace or aviation brands through tailored spear-phishing, fake career portals, fraudulent videoconferencing invitations, and job-description lures. More recent activity also included search-engine optimization poisoning that impersonated legitimate software-download sites. These campaigns deliver multi-stage malware through trusted or signed software components, .NET AppDomainManager hijacking, DLL sideloading, and malicious configuration abuse. The actor has deployed multiple custom implants and supporting tools, including MiniJunk, MiniFast, MiniBrowse, NightLedger, TWOSTROKE, and DEEPROOT. Its backdoors provide host and network reconnaissance, process and directory enumeration, command execution, file and DLL operations, screenshot capture, data upload and download, remote tasking, and scheduled-task persistence. MiniBrowse has been used to collect browser-stored credentials. Nimbus Manticore also uses bespoke tunneling utilities, including WebSocket- and SOCKS-based proxies, to relay operator traffic through compromised systems and maintain covert access. Recent malware exhibits increased obfuscation, use of cloud-hosted command-and-control infrastructure, anti-analysis logic, and in some cases indicators of AI-assisted development.
